#b69c52 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b69c52 is composed of 71.4% red, 61.2%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 14.3% magenta, 54.9%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 44.4 degrees, a saturation of 40.7% and a lightness of 51.8%. #b69c52 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a4 with #6d3900.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

#b69c52 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#b69c52 has RGB values of R:182, G:156, B:82 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.14, Y:0.55,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11967570.

Hex triplet b69c52 #b69c52
RGB Decimal 182, 156, 82 rgb(182,156,82)
RGB Percent 71.4, 61.2, 32.2 rgb(71.4%,61.2%,32.2%)
CMYK 0, 14, 55, 29
HSL 44.4°, 40.7, 51.8 hsl(44.4,40.7%,51.8%)
HSV (or HSB) 44.4°, 54.9, 71.4
Web Safe cc9966 #cc9966
CIE-LAB 65.225, 0.254, 41.849
XYZ 32.703, 34.332, 12.886
xyY 0.409, 0.43, 34.332
CIE-LCH 65.225, 41.85, 89.652
CIE-LUV 65.225, 21.416, 49.723
Hunter-Lab 58.594, -2.913, 27.976
Binary 10110110, 10011100, 01010010

Shades and Tints of #b69c52

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060503 is the darkest color, while #fcfbf8 is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#b69c52 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#9b9b9b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#a09b8c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#b3a35b Protanopia 1% of men
  • #c69c5c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#c198a3 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#b4a058 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#c09c58 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#bd9985 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
